Как объединить атрибуты в кубах винзавода? - PullRequest
0 голосов
/ 31 декабря 2018

Я хотел бы знать, есть ли способ определить атрибут в одном измерении, где его метка (label_attribute) будет конкатом из двух столбцов, чтобы он интерпретировался механизмом sql как:

concat (lastname, “ ", firstname) as fullname

Например, у меня в моей модели:

…… ...

"name":"employees",
        "label": “Employees",
        "levels": [
               {
                   "name”:"employee",
                   "label”:"Employee",
                   "attributes": ["id", "lastname", "firstname"],
                   "label_attribute":"lastname"                           
               }
           ]
       },

Это может быть что-то вроде:

"label_attribute”:{“expression”:  “concat(employees.lastname, ‘  ‘ , employees.firstname)”}

или даже в другойКстати, важно то, что я могу использовать функцию concat в объединенной таблице вместо добавления столбца с именем fullname в таблицу фактов.

Будут оценены все предложения.

Спасибо.

...